Output e60ee653a39f9ce46675dd063ccfd0e3a5b23d859dc8038e07a8300e6dc841b4:0

value
2348920
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 98d604b7b603b509b33274ade232358e422ea41c OP_EQUALVERIFY OP_CHECKSIG
address
1Ew86RKZBYrYVv4BwdvJExRHibHBFmUbek
transaction
e60ee653a39f9ce46675dd063ccfd0e3a5b23d859dc8038e07a8300e6dc841b4
confirmations
281898
spent
true